In Zimbabwe, Africa, you will find the magnificent Victoria Falls, at a height of 420 feet. The location is known as the “Devil’s Swimming Pool”. During the months of September and December, people can swim as close as possible to the edge of the falls without falling over. These falls are becoming well known amongst the “radical tourist” industry, when more and more people search for the ultimate experience.
The pool is a real phenomenon, a natural rock pool at the very top of Victoria Falls. The terrifying aspect of such an adventure is heightened for first time visitors because the pool does not appear to have any sort of barrier (natural or otherwise) to protect swimmers who jump into it from being swept over the edge of the falls.
